The standard format for git commit logs is something like this:

----------------------------------------------------------------------
When getting HW rfkill we get stop_device being called from two paths.
One path is the IRQ calling stop device, and updating op mode and stack.
As a result, cfg80211 is running rfkill sync work that shuts down all
devices (second path). In the second path, we eventually get to
iwl_mvm_stop_device which calls iwl_fw_dump_conf_clear->iwl_fw_dbg_stop_recording,
that access periphery registers.

The device may be stopped at this point from the first path,
which will result with a failure to access those registers. Simply
checking for the trans status is insufficient, since the race will still
exist, only minimized. Instead, move the stop from
iwl_fw_dump_conf_clear (which is getting called only from stop path) to
the transport stop device function, where the access is always safe.
This has the added value, of actually stopping dbgc before stopping
device even when the stop is initiated from the transport.
